Lace Cap -
The Ties and Rosettes
1. Cut four 12" (30.5-cm) lengths of the 5/8”-wide
(16-mm) ribbon, two for the ties and two for the rosettes.
2. Fold up the end of one piece of ribbon 5/8”
(16 mm), then fold the ribbon in half lengthwise, covering
the end, and stitch the long edges together with five
1/8” long (9.5-mm) running stitches, spaced 1/8”
(9.5 mm) apart.
3. Pull the ribbon up tightly into folds along the thread
to form the rosette, and secure the folds with two or
three fastening stitches. Repeat to make the second
rosette.
4. Attach the ties and rosettes to the cap by placing
a rosette over one end of each tie at each of the front
corners of the cap, and make several tiny stitches through
the center of the rosette to secure all three layers
together.
5 . With three-strand lengths of embroidery floss, make
a cluster of four or five white and four or five pale-green
French knots through the center of each rosette to hide
the earlier stitches and to fasten the folds tightly
Trim the ends of the ties on the diagonal.
